Comprehensive Curriculum Coverage
One of the first features to evaluate is whether the training program covers the complete CCIE Enterprise Infrastructure blueprint.
A comprehensive curriculum should include:
Enterprise routing
Enterprise switching
Software-Defined Access (SD-Access)
Cisco SD-WAN
Wireless networking
Infrastructure security
Network services
Automation and programmability
High availability
Network troubleshooting
Complete syllabus coverage ensures candidates are well prepared for both theoretical and practical assessments.
